HI, Many thanks! it can work on Solid body? I tried, but when I'm going to Edit Sketch the Bodies section disappears from the browser, and I cant find and mark the faces. why?
@planejanemodeling
@planejanemodeling 5 ай бұрын
Hi, hmmm. Fusion does this thing where moving from sketches to bodies etc, it'll automatically hide certain things. I supposed this makes sense going from sketch to body as the sketch becomes the secondary point of interest. I can't remember if I showed it in this video or mentioned it. But there is a quick step where you turn the surface into a body. And this is where you'd use a very small number with the point being to turn the surface into a body. And once you have a body, then you can make cuts into it using this workflow. Create your curved surface. It'll appear on the tree as a surface body. Then thicken this curve surface. This will create a new body in the tree that you can then project the sketches onto. Sometimes going back and forth between sketches and bodies you'll have to manually check the visibility (eye) icon in the tree. Let me know if this makes sense.
